The site could be temporarily unavailable or too busy. Try again in a few moments.
If you are unable to load any pages, check your computer’s network connection.
If your computer or network is protected by a firewall or proxy, make sure that Firefox is permitted to access the web.
It appears that the website IP your site is on had some stability issues yesterday. Even though the actual downtime was only very short, there may have been longer periods of poor performance.